Output d8ffbb43625ef5bfc743e2beeae1d34f3dbcae667e8bd64d8ae5ad05ca98a8ff:4

value
1096842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d2cd014f03463ed691ca0b715de3b6f1ef950a OP_EQUAL
address
3HzYjPLo2vVSzg2CL4jdKBrn9Hhvv6pZzN
transaction
d8ffbb43625ef5bfc743e2beeae1d34f3dbcae667e8bd64d8ae5ad05ca98a8ff
confirmations
425328
spent
true